Course overview

Studying for an MSc by Research can be an excellent opportunity to develop your intellectual and research skills and your academic interest in a particular field. The MSc by Research is a 12-month research project (24 months part-time). It is distinct from our taught Masters programmes which involve taught courses that are formally assessed with part of the year spent on a research project.

With support from your supervisors, you'll work full time on planning, implementing and writing up a research project for your MSc by research. You will be supervised by at least two members of academic staff and will be encouraged to submit your work for publication where appropriate.
